Easy Vegetable Beef Soup

This Easy Vegetable Beef Soup brings comfort and balance with tender beef, fresh vegetables, and a light, flavorful broth. It’s a simple, nourishing meal perfect for busy days while still feeling homemade and satisfying.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: Soup
Cuisine: International
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 400 g beef stew meat cut into chunks
  • 2 carrots chopped
  • 2 potatoes diced
  • 1 cup green beans trimmed
  • 1 onion diced
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 4 cups beef broth
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• salt to taste
  • black pepper to taste
  • 1 tsp Italian herbs

Equipment

  • Large Pot

Method
 

  1. Chop carrots, potatoes, and green beans. Dice onion and mince garlic.
  2. Pat the beef dry to help it brown properly.
  3.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at.
  4. Add the beef and cook until browned on all sides.
  5. Add onion and garlic, cooking until soft and fragrant.
  6. Pour in beef broth and diced tomatoes. Stir well.
  7. Add carrots, potatoes, and green beans.
  8. Season with salt, pepper, and Italian herbs. Bring to a boil.
  9. Reduce heat and simmer for 30–40 minutes until beef is tender.
  10.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.
  11. Let the soup rest for a few minutes, then serve warm.
